Finance team: the licensing dispute with Corvat Systems over the Vexley toolkit remains unresolved. Escrow reserve stays at current levels through Q2. Do not release accrued royalties. Legal expects mediation within eight weeks; budget accordingly. Renewal negotiations for adjacent contracts are paused. Any invoices referencing Vexley components route to central review. Forecast impact: contained, assuming settlement by mid-year. Contingency scenarios are in the appendix. The confidential strategic position on settlement terms follows below.

board note of bawep-tajef: Queniusek Systems plans to raise the Quenvan list price by 53.1 percent in March. The pricing group signed off on a budget of $176.4 million for Project Drueth. The renewal with Casionix Partners closes at $142.5 million a year, 8.3 percent below the last contract. Project Fraax slips by six weeks because of the tooling delay.

## Onboarding: User Module Extraction

We're carving the user module out of the Brindlewort monolith into its own service. Auth flows move first; profile data follows next sprint. Contract tests gate every cutover, and the strangler proxy routes by path prefix. Deploys to the new service require the team deploy key shown here:

release key, kahif-yagap: bky3_1JN

Internal Memo — Revised Sales-Commission Scheme

To: Incoming Director, Commercial

From January, Fernwall Group moves to a tiered commission model: base rate drops two points, with accelerators above 110% of quota and a team multiplier for the Northgate region. Payroll systems are ready; the sales leads have been briefed. Expect pushback from senior reps on the cap. The reasoning ties into next year's direction, summarised below.

internal memo for bawef-kajef: Novokix Logistics is in early talks to buy Briaelax Freight for about $167.0 million. The Zorius launch date is April 3, and nothing goes to the press before then. Legal wants the Frairax Holdings term sheet redrafted before August 10.